Drug treatment courts are specialized interventions aimed at assisting individuals with substance use and mental health disorders, promoting long-term recovery, family reunification, community protection, and cost savings. They provide evidence-based treatment, community supervision, and medication-assisted treatment to combat the opioid epidemic, demonstrating effectiveness in reducing drug use, recidivism, and improving family dynamics. The vision for these courts emphasizes accessible treatment for all participants, overdose prevention education, and the safe use of overdose reversal medications.
